Company History and Business Evolution

The founding story of the University of Liverpool is a narrative of ambition and evolution, rooted in the industrial and medical needs of the 19th century. The institution began its journey in 1881 as University College Liverpool, established to provide professional training and higher education in a rapidly expanding port city. The early development was characterized by a vision to bridge the gap between academic theory and practical industrial application, a philosophy that continues to define the University of Liverpool company profile today. Early leadership, including pioneering figures in medicine and engineering, successfully navigated the complexities of growth, leading to the university receiving its Royal Charter in 1903. This major milestone officially established the University of Liverpool as an independent entity with the power to award its own degrees. Throughout the 20th and 21st centuries, the organization underwent significant expansion phases, including the development of international campuses, such as the landmark partnership in Suzhou, China. This business evolution saw the university transition from a regional center of learning to a global research powerhouse, known for its technology development in fields like infectious diseases, materials chemistry, and personalized medicine. By consistently adapting its curriculum and research focus to meet global challenges, the university has evolved into a trusted industry participant that shapes the future of multiple sectors.

  • Established in 1881 as University College Liverpool, reflecting a long-standing commitment to urban education.

  • The university gained its Royal Charter in 1903, marking its independence and authority as a degree-awarding body.

  • Pioneer of the "Redbrick" university movement, representing institutions founded in major industrial cities.

  • Significant global expansion in 2006 with the founding of Xi'an Jiaotong-Liverpool University (XJTLU) in China.
